Baroda BNP Paribas Mutual FundEquity Scheme - Dividend Yield Fund2 years
The scheme seeks to provide medium to long term appreciation by predominantly investing in a well-diversified portfolio of equity and equity related instruments of dividend yielding companies. There is no assurance that the investment objective of the Scheme will be achieved.
